The Winch Drives market is experiencing steady growth, driven by increased demand for efficient and high-performing winch systems across various industries. Winch drives are essential for providing mechanical power for winches, which are widely used in different sectors such as marine, construction, and machinery industries. Winch drives convert electrical, hydraulic, or manual power into mechanical energy to facilitate the operation of winches, which are integral for hauling, lifting, or pulling loads. In the Marine sector, winch drives are critical for various operations such as anchor handling, towing, and mooring systems, where precise and reliable power transmission is paramount. The marine industry’s reliance on winches to manage the ropes, cables, and chains necessary for securing vessels in place has created a steady demand for winch drives. The winches are commonly found in both commercial and military vessels, oil rigs, and other maritime applications. In the Machinery industry, winch drives are widely used in applications such as cranes, hoists, and other lifting equipment. The increasing demand for large-scale construction projects, infrastructure development, and mining operations drives the need for robust winch systems that can handle heavy lifting tasks efficiently. Winch drives in cranes, for instance, are responsible for the operation of hoisting mechanisms, which are essential for vertical and horizontal lifting of materials. These systems ensure the smooth operation of various lifting and hoisting functions across industries, such as construction, mining, and heavy manufacturing. The 'Others' segment of the Winch Drives market encompasses a diverse range of applications where winch systems are used but do not fall under the Marine or Machinery categories. This includes industries such as forestry, agriculture, automotive, and even entertainment. In forestry, winch systems are used in logging operations to transport large logs. In the automotive industry, winches are used in off-road vehicles for towing and recovery. In agriculture, winches play a role in tasks such as irrigation and equipment handling. The broad use of winch drives in these sectors ensures that this market segment remains significant, though it may not be as large as marine or machinery-based applications.
In the entertainment industry, winches are used for managing rigging systems in theaters and for various production setups in films and stage shows. 1. What is a winch drive?
A winch drive is a mechanical system that provides the necessary power for operating winches, which are used for lifting, pulling, or hauling heavy loads in various industries.
2. What industries use winch drives?
Winch drives are used in industries such as marine, construction, mining, automotive, agriculture, forestry, and entertainment, among others.
3. What is the role of winch drives in the marine industry?
In the marine industry, winch drives are crucial for anchoring, towing, mooring, and other operations that require lifting or pulling heavy loads in maritime environments.
4. How do winch drives contribute to construction equipment?
Winch drives are used in construction cranes and hoists to lift and move heavy materials, making them integral to construction projects and infrastructure development.
5. What is the difference between electric and hydraulic winch drives?
Electric winch drives use electric motors for power, while hydraulic winch drives rely on hydraulic fluid to generate force, each offering different advantages depending on the application.
